The 2013 Suzuki Alto's 81.2% pass rate sits just above the UK average of 80%, suggesting broadly typical reliability for its age—but the 37.7% of vehicles that have ever had a dangerous defect is a red flag that warrants pre-purchase inspection. This high proportion of serious safety issues means one in three Altos on the road has experienced something genuinely hazardous.
With a median mileage of 39,413 miles for an 11-year-old car, these Altos are lightly driven, which partially explains the decent pass rate; however, the average of 2.42 failures and 16.1 advisories per vehicle shows maintenance is a persistent concern. Before buying, have a trusted mechanic inspect the brakes, suspension, and lights thoroughly—these are likely to be the culprits behind those dangerous defects.
The 2013 Suzuki Alto has a decent first-time pass rate (81.2%), but a higher-than-average share of vehicles have had serious defects recorded — the individual vehicle's history matters a lot here.

Mileage Distribution
Most 2013 Suzuki Alto vehicles sit in the blue band. If the vehicle you're looking at is outside it, it's either unusually low or high mileage for its age.
Half of all 2013 Suzuki Alto vehicles fall between 27,200 and 53,996 miles.
2013 Suzuki Alto — Still on the Road
Most 2013 Suzuki Altos are still being driven.
Strong survival — 11,009 vehicles still getting MOTs in 2025, 89% of the peak.
Based on vehicles from this manufacture year that had at least one MOT test in each calendar year. Data from 2016–2025.
* The 2020 dip reflects the government's COVID-19 MOT exemption, which allowed certificates to be extended by six months — fewer tests were conducted that year.
